edit, forgot that you asked about registration. In NY state it's $100 to register a sled unless you belong to a snowmobile club, then its $45. It cost me $25 to join the Hilton Snow Fliers, so in the end I saved $30 which isnt too bad. You need to get insurance on them too, but thats not too expensive.

So would you compare riding a snowmobile like riding the dunes but faster? I have always wanted to try a snowmobile, but if you are riding on a mountain how do you not cause an avalanche?

I've never ridden the dunes but it looks like a heck of a lot of fun. Basically you can do the trail riding, field riding, or lake riding around where I am. I know there are more types, but that is what I do. The trail riding is different from an atv in that you typically need more room, wider trails, and they are usually groomed to be nice and flat. Field riding is fun, you start at one end and just get back as far as you can on the seat and gun it see how fast you can get without hitting any rocks. Never done any lake riding, but thats where I hear my friends saying they hit 110 or 120. So I have never tried a mountain, but I just assume that it wouldnt be that lose of snow. Maybe someday
